Absolutely LOVED their street tacos. Came in for a quick lunch with our family during coronagate 2020. We were on spring break and making the best of our trip. Just loved it. The kids all got breakfast tacos that they devoured. I had the pork street tacos which I loved. I tried my dad’s beef street tacos which were also great. But aside from the well-marinate meat that’s comes on these tacos, the star, for me, was the tortilla. They’re corn (duh, because street tacos) which I normally don’t love, but these were excellent. They were texturally the best I’ve had (in my gringa opinion). A bit yellow in color, I’m guessing they are on the eggy side which I apparently like. Each table has two hot sauces to choose from—MH loved the green best. And his guisado taco was excellent as well—this one on flour and from the breakfast list. Super juicy and flavorful. Anyway, no one had a bad thing to say. We really enjoyed our tacos. The ambience here was also great. Comfortable and casual but clean and refreshing. The staff is friendly. They did a great job converting this old house. They’re only open for breakfast and lunch, so get here before they close at 2. Accessibility note: For an old house, this has great accessibility. The tables are fairly spaced out and there are three entrances. Plenty of room to get around.
